Burns v. DHS

June 10, 2026 ·24-1463 ·Panel Decision ·Per Curiam · By Aisha Johnson

The United States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it affirmed a decision by the Merit Systems Protection Board. This nonprecedential ruling resolves a petition for review filed by Shawn Burns against the Department of Homeland Security.

Background

Petitioner Shawn Burns sought review of a Merit Systems Protection Board decision in a dispute with the Department of Homeland Security.

The court’s reasoning

The court issued a per curiam judgment without providing written reasoning in this nonprecedential order.

What it means going forward

The Merit Systems Protection Board’s decision remains in effect.
